Our franchise selection process is outlined below and is
designed to help us find great people who will enjoy owning
a DoodyCalls franchise. The process will help you—a
prospective DoodyCalls franchise owner—decide if a
DoodyCalls franchise matches your interests and talents.
Please follow the steps below to learn more about us. As
you move through these steps we'll learn about one another.
- Step 1: The first step is to request DoodyCalls franchise
information online or to call us directly at 1.800.DoodyCalls
(1.800.366.3922). We'll arrange
a time to review the material with you.
- Step 2: We will explain the opportunity to you and answer
initial questions you may have about DoodyCalls. We will
send a Franchise Qualification Form to you to complete
and arrange a time to discuss the questionnaire with you.
- Step 3: Your completed questionnaire will be the basis
for a discussion with you. Our conversation will help both
of us determine if you and DoodyCalls are a good match.
- Step 4: If we both think that DoodyCalls is a business
you would enjoy, then we'll invite you to our office in
Charlottesville, Virginia. While in Charlottesville, you'll learn more about
all aspects of DoodyCalls and meet our local franchise
partners.
- Step 5: After your visit, you'll be ready to decide if
DoodyCalls is a good opportunity for you. Based on our
conversations and pertinent documentation, we'll decide
whether or not to invite you to join the team.
